Runbook: Bellgrove Timetabler solver stalls

If the solver hangs past ten minutes, it's almost always an over-constrained elective block. Kill the run, bump the relaxation tier, and requeue — don't restart the whole node. Before requeueing, double-check the worker is loaded with the expected settings, which should read as follows:

service settings:
PRAIX_LOG_LEVEL=error
PRAIX_METRICS_HOST=metrics.praix.qorvelcorp.corp
PRAIX_POOL_SIZE=16

// --- SpoolHub client setup ---
// This block wires up the client for Pinwheel's printer-spooler
// microservice. Heads up: the spooler is picky about auth — every
// call needs a key, even the health check, which trips up basically
// every new contractor in week one. Retries are built in, so don't
// add your own loop or you'll double-print (yes, that happened).
// Timeouts default to 5s; leave them alone unless ops says otherwise.
// For local dev, initialize the client with the internal key below.

API key for fahip-kahip: zpat23_XiJGUHz5xfaAtaIqUkus0rh

Minutes — Management Meeting, Varnholt Systems

Attendees: R. Quillen (Chair), M. Darrow, T. Ebsen.

The committee reviewed the Q3 marketing budget and approved a 22% reduction, effective next month. Spend on the Lumabrand campaign will be paused; retained funds shift to the Kestrel product launch in Ostermere. Darrow will present revised channel allocations at the next session. No staffing changes are proposed at this stage. The board is asked to note the following item before wider circulation.

management briefing: The northern region missed its Jorael quota by 14.5 percent last quarter. Nordorax Logistics plans to lower the Casdor list price by 61.4 percent in July. The board signed off on a budget of $219.8 million for Project Tamax. The renewal with Briielax Foods closes at $51.2 million a year, 65.4 percent above the last contract.